The Public Defender Office of the 19th Circuit in Florida, led by Diamond R. Litty since 1992, employs a holistic approach to public defense, focusing on ethical and zealous representation in court. Their commitment extends beyond the courtroom, as they provide resources for employment, substance abuse counseling, and educational direction through their 501-c-3 Lifebuilders program, aimed at breaking the cycle of crime.

With a mission to enhance community welfare, the office has introduced innovative programs designed to reduce recidivism and save taxpayer dollars, thereby improving the overall service provided to the community. Through initiatives like "Legal Affairs," hosted by Ms. Litty, they engage in discussions about legal issues impacting the public, furthering their dedication to serving the community effectively.
